Sling.com Beta Testing Underway

According to an e-mail that found its way into several mailboxes yesterday, Sling Media took a step closer to the launch of the Sling.com online entertainment portal by opening it up to beta testers.

"Sling.com is a new online video portal that will give users access to a premier library of content from top TV networks, movie studios, sports leagues and websites. Combining professional programming, editorial expertise and social networking features alongside easy and logical navigation," according to the company.

While Sling's e-mail gave no clues as to whether or not Clip+Sling, the long-awaited feature that allows Slingbox owners to clip segments of shows right from their SlingPlayer and share it with others, is included in the early release of the portal. However, Sling Media's relationships with networks and other content providers should offer a bevy of entertainemnt options at launch.

Even more interesting is the inclusion of a web-based SlingPlayer, which will let Slingbox owners connect to and control their home television devices without a separate application installed. Not much is known yet about exactly how it works or what the limitations may be, but having a web-based alternative could be a huge convenience for Slingers.
